Most Common Questions Asked By Couples
I'm in Patna, where do I actually file for divorce?
You’ll need to file your divorce petition (the official starting document) at the Family Court in Patna. This court handles marriage and family-related legal matters in the city.
What's the difference between Mutual and Contested Divorce in Patna?
This works the same way across India, including Patna:
- Mutual Consent: The smoother road. Both you and your spouse agree to divorce and have worked out the details (money, property, kids). You file the case together. Generally quicker and less stressful.
- Contested: This is when one person wants the divorce and the other doesn’t, OR you fundamentally disagree on important terms (like alimony or custody). It involves more back-and-forth in court, evidence, arguments, and takes much longer. One person files against the other.
How long does a divorce usually take in Patna?
- Mutual Consent: Expect it to take roughly 6 to 18 months. This includes the mandatory 6-month “cooling-off” period after you first file. How busy the Patna Family Court is can affect the exact timing.
- Contested: No easy answer here, unfortunately. It could be a year, maybe two, or even drag on longer, depending on how complex the disagreements are and the court’s schedule.

Do I absolutely need a lawyer for my divorce in the Patna Family Court?
Legally, you can represent yourself, but it’s not recommended, especially if things are contested.
- Why? Divorce law involves specific procedures, rules of evidence, and deadlines. A lawyer familiar with the Patna courts knows how to navigate the system, draft documents correctly, and crucially, protect your rights regarding finances and children. It’s easy to make costly mistakes on your own.
- Even for mutual consent, a lawyer helps ensure your settlement agreement (MoU) is fair, legally binding, and covers all necessary points to avoid future issues.
How are decisions about kids and money (Custody & Alimony) made in Patna?
These are based on Indian law, as interpreted by the Patna Family Court:
- Child Custody: The court’s main concern is always the child’s best interest and welfare. This could result in sole custody, joint custody, or specific visitation rights being granted.
- Alimony/Maintenance: This is about financial support. The court considers factors like both spouses’ incomes, needs, lifestyle during the marriage, and how long the marriage lasted. There’s no fixed percentage or automatic entitlement.
That 6-month "cooling-off" period in mutual divorce – can we get it waived in Patna?
This is the standard waiting time mandated by law (Section 13B(2) of the Hindu Marriage Act) to give couples a final chance to reconsider.
- Can it be skipped (waived)? Yes, potentially. Following Supreme Court guidelines, the Patna Family Court judge has the discretion to waive it if specific conditions are met: you’ve already been separated for a substantial period (typically 18+ months), you’ve settled all issues (finances, property, kids), and there’s absolutely no chance of reconciliation.
- Important: It’s not guaranteed. You must file a specific application requesting the waiver, and the judge in Patna will decide based on the facts of your case.
What basic documents do I need for a mutual divorce in Patna?
Start gathering these:
- Proof of Marriage (Marriage Certificate preferred; wedding photos/invitation might suffice if the certificate is missing)
- Address Proof for both spouses (Aadhaar, Passport, Voter ID, utility bill)
- Identity Proof for both (PAN, Aadhaar, Passport, etc.)
- Recent passport-sized photos of both
- Proof you’ve been living separately for over a year (e.g., separate rental agreements, affidavits)
- Your written Settlement Agreement/MoU (detailing terms for alimony, property, etc.)
- Income/financial documents might be needed depending on your settlement.
